Info for GT3 drivers (relays problems)
Had a problem with the RS at the Ring, it was mega hot, and i noticed my fan was not coming on when parked in the car park, while Cem's was on most of the time when parked next to mine, oil was running very hot too, 1st time i noticed this on the car.
Anyway, Mark at 9M said he may know what the problem is, and had a look in the back of the car where the electronics are, under the carpert of the rear deck.
He was spot on with his suspicions, as he said that the Relays sometimes work loose, he took the panel off, and no less than 3 of the things were off, rattling around !!!
Plugged 1st one in, and fan came on straight away, not sure what the others do, but i'm sure they're there for a reason !!
Plugged them back in, and taped them up. Obviously due to the bouncey nature of the Ring, they worked their way loose, but still think this is a bit poor.
Anyway, just thought i'd let anyone know in case they have the same problem.
